Overview

Link interface modules are essential components in modern industrial and communication systems. They act as intermediaries, enabling seamless data exchange between different devices or systems. These modules are designed to support various communication protocols, ensuring compatibility across diverse platforms. Their role is critical in automation, telecommunications, and networking, where reliable and high-speed data transmission is paramount. By integrating these modules, businesses can enhance system efficiency, reduce downtime, and improve overall performance.

Structure and Working Principle

A typical link interface module consists of a housing, connectors, and internal circuitry. The housing is usually made of durable materials to protect the internal components from environmental factors. Connectors are designed to match specific port types, ensuring secure physical connections. The internal circuitry includes signal processors and protocol converters, which translate data formats between connected devices. This allows for smooth communication even between systems that use different protocols. The module's working principle revolves around receiving, processing, and transmitting data signals with minimal latency.

Key Features

Link interface modules are known for their high-speed data transfer capabilities, often supporting rates up to several gigabits per second. They are also designed for reliability, with features like error correction and signal amplification to maintain data integrity. Another key feature is their compatibility with multiple communication protocols, such as Ethernet, RS-232, and USB. This versatility makes them suitable for a wide range of applications. Additionally, many modules offer plug-and-play functionality, simplifying installation and reducing setup time.

Application Areas

These modules are widely used in industrial automation, where they connect sensors, controllers, and actuators. They are also prevalent in telecommunications, enabling data exchange between network devices like routers and switches. In the networking sector, link interface modules facilitate connections between servers and storage systems. Other applications include automotive systems, medical devices, and consumer electronics, where reliable data transmission is crucial.

Maintenance and Precautions

To ensure longevity, link interface modules should be kept clean and free from dust. Regular inspections can help identify loose connections or signs of wear. It's also important to avoid exposing the modules to extreme temperatures or humidity. When installing or replacing a module, always follow the manufacturer's guidelines. Using incompatible connectors or exceeding voltage ratings can damage the module and connected devices. Proper grounding is also essential to prevent electrical interference.

B2B Procurement Guide

When purchasing link interface modules, start by assessing your specific needs, such as data transfer speed and protocol requirements. Verify compatibility with existing systems to avoid integration issues. Consider the environmental conditions where the module will be used. For harsh environments, look for modules with robust housing and IP ratings. It's also advisable to source from reputable suppliers who offer technical support and warranties. Bulk purchases may qualify for discounts, but always prioritize quality over cost.
